Bollywood star diva Alia Bhatt has tested positive for Coronavirus. The news was confirmed by the actress herself on her Insta story which reads, "Hello all, I have tested positive for COVID-19. I have immediately isolated myself and will be under home quarantine. I am following all safety protocols under the advice of my doctors." Alia also thanked concerned fans in her post, adding: "Grateful for all your love and support. Please stay safe and take care."

Last month, filmmaker Sanjay Leela Bhansali whose directing Gangubai Kathiawadi starring Alia tested positive for Covid. The film got delayed owing to the incident.  Later Alia’s boyfriend Ranbir Kapoor also contracted the virus, wherein Alia informed her fans that she underwent the test and has been negative. Ironically days after RANbir recovered, now Alia has contracted the virus.

On the work front, Alia is a busy bee who has big projects in her kitty. She has Ayan Mukerji's Brahmastra, then  Gangubai Kathiawadi  which will clash at the box-office with Prabhas’ starrer Radhe Shyam, then she has most talked about RRR under Rajamouli’s direction. 

Alia was supposed to join the sets of RRR in the month of April. But with the actress testing positive for Covid, RRR team has got a joltas the shoot may get delayed. Now it is to be seen if RRR will get released on the mentioned date or not i.e October 13.
